A Liberal Arts and Sciences Option
The program provides graduates with two years of college-level language instruction and background in international studies. It is appropriate for students who plan to transfer after graduation to complete the bachelor’s degree requirements and whose career goals are in the filed of teaching, law, government, language translation, management of non-profit organizations, or international affairs. The program especially accommodates the student who desires to complete a two-year program in general education or who wants to take college-level courses for his or her own satisfaction. Graduates have transferred to four-year institutions as majors in communications, modern languages, political science, business, sociology and history.

Associate in Arts Degree
The university-parallel curriculums are designed to meet the basic requirements of the first two years of college programs for students who plan to graduate and transfer to a senior college or university to study for the baccalaureate degree. They offer a wide range of flexibility in terms of the student’s ultimate educational goals and provide adequate preparation for further study leading to professional competence in specialized fields. These programs also accommodate individuals who seek two years of a liberal higher education.
